Agricultural Transformation

Agriculture in sub-Saharan Africa is undergoing significant changes, driven by a combination of rising rural populations, the emergence of investor farmers, and structural shifts in labor markets. These dynamics are not just altering the agricultural landscape; they are reshaping the very foundations of rural economies and societies. As these trends unfold, they prompt critical questions about the future of agriculture on the continent and the pathways of adaptation that will define the region's agricultural transformation.
